Oklahoma National Guardsman Dead After Highway Crash
Posted on Thursday, April 9th, 2020 at 7:48 pm
An Oklahoma National Guardsman died after a car crash, an April 8 article of KOCO News 5 reported.
Army Private 1st Class Mason T. Ward died after crashing into a horse. Ward enlisted in the Oklahoma Army National Guard in June 2018 as a motor transport operator with Company A, 120th Engineer Battalion, 90th Troop Command. His recent duty was guarding the Armed Forces Reserve Center in Broken Arrow during the coronavirus pandemic.
